Output afdc90c5fee7e05ab095366c61355fca7311143619620a9a6a5cc39b0167e4bd:0

value
20882
script pubkey
OP_0 OP_PUSHBYTES_20 b90d66f0488e1e258abbc5df6f366557a519f439
address
bc1qhyxkduzg3c0ztz4mch0k7dn927j3napefpqczp
transaction
afdc90c5fee7e05ab095366c61355fca7311143619620a9a6a5cc39b0167e4bd
confirmations
130243
spent
true